For 30 years, there have been shootings at the borders, from time to time their intensity increases or decreases, we should not take it tragically. Opposition MP Garnik Danielyan stated this speaking with reporters Tuesday in the National Assembly of Armenia.
According to him, Azerbaijan's objective is to create an atmosphere of panic in Armenia’s society after every shooting.
"In the case of previous shootings, they [i.e. the Azerbaijanis] received an adequate response and forgot about it for several months, until they provoked another provocation; that's their methodology. Suppose the [Armenian] authorities surrender those four villages [in Tavush Province to Azerbaijan]. Will the [Azerbaijani] shooting stop after that? It will be much worse, they will shoot from much more favorable positions. Their goal is to make the surrounding villages unviable," Danielyan added.
The opposition member of the parliament noted that for a long time the Armenian authorities said that they do not negotiate on those four villages.
"But 15 days ago, he [i.e. Armenian PM Nikol Pashinyan] came, stood in the village and said: ‘People, they should be surrendered.’ He said we will give four villages, then we will see what demands Azerbaijan makes. (…). The [natural] gas pipeline also passes through that section," said the opposition legislator.
Also, he noted that if the Armenian authorities say that these are Azerbaijani lands, Azerbaijan says that “if it is so, we can launch an attack at any time, capture the Armenian soldiers standing there.”
"[Border] demarcation has not been done. If it’s not done, who can say whose territory it is? It’s not by saying. I also say it is not like that. Armenia has two reasons for this. One [is] that it entered the USSR, those maps should be taken as a basis. And the other is leaving the USSR. (…). As long as the authorities of Armenia are afraid, Azerbaijan will demand," Garnik Danielyan stated, in particular.
